SAE-AISI 9255 Steel vs. S28200 Stainless Steel

Both SAE-AISI 9255 steel and S28200 stainless steel are iron alloys. Both are furnished in the annealed condition. They have 62%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 27 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(7,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is SAE-AISI 9255 steel and the bottom bar is S28200 stainless steel.
